Binding sites for corticotropin releasing factor in sensory areas of the rat hindbrain and spinal cord.

G Skofitsch, T R Insel, D M Jacobowitz.   

Abstract

Binding sites of 125I-Tyr-O-ovine corticotropin releasing factor have been demonstrated in sensory areas of the rat hindbrain and spinal cord mainly in the posterior part of the nucleus tractus solitarii, the substantia gelatinosa nervi trigemini and the superficial layers of the spinal cord (laminae I and II). Specific binding was inhibited in the presence of unlabeled synthetic ovine or rat/human CRF indicating that the receptors recognize both forms of CRF.
